Audiences from 11% share, even deferred
For the Spanish GP F1 race, at 15pm live su SkySportF1, channel 207, are counted 1 million 87 thousand average viewers. Thus arriving at 9,2% of share.
In deferred, at 18 pm, on channel 8 of digital terrestrial are counted 1 million 237 thousand average viewers, With the '11% of share.
